Qasas Ul Anbiya (Stories of the Prophets) in is a popular transliterated version of classical Islamic texts that narrate the lives, trials, and divine missions of the prophets mentioned in the Quran and Hadith. This format is specifically designed for readers who understand Urdu/Hindi but are more comfortable reading the Latin (Roman) alphabet. Key Content & Features Qasas Ul Anbiya In Roman English Pdf

The arrogance of Ibleis (Satan) and the expulsion from Paradise. Life on Earth and the first family. 2. The Great Flood: Hazrat Nuh (AS) The spread of idolatry among mankind. Hazrat Nuh’s (Noah) patient preaching for 950 years. The construction of the Ark ( Kashti ). The divine storm and the cleansing of the Earth. 3. The Father of Prophets: Hazrat Ibrahim (AS) Standing up against the tyrant Namrud (Nimrod). The miracle of the cool fire.
